New in Version 2.04
- Added an option to Relink All Bitmaps and not just missing ones. The checkbox “All Maps” should do the trick.
- Fixed a bug with the licensing system, if you have requested a license in the past and it wasn’t working, please email colin.senner@gmail.com your new request code (Generated by clicking the “Donate!” button). Old License files will continue to work, but they now have a new format
- Command Line support added for “All Maps” feature (check the FAQ at the bottom for syntax)
- The new version deletes your “Relink Bitmaps.ini” file because new features have been added to it, this is to prevent errors. Reconfigure manually.
- Fixed the icon not showing up properly after install (Thanks Artur)

It’s useful for me in two ways:
One is that it allows me to setup materials using maps in a particular job folder and at the end when I archive the job and transfer the materials into my database I can dump the textures to my primary file morgue and quickly relink them all. I often do this while the job is still live on my drives so the maps are not missing per se.
The other use I would have is that occasionally I set up a whole folder of lo-res versions of hi-res images (when they are in the 8-10K range this pays off a lot) but keep the name the same, so that I can quickly re-link them by pointing to a new folder. I normally do this by temporarily re-naming their folders so the link in Max gets broken and Relink can work, but now this will be a one-step thing.
Minor things, but I do this all the time so I’m happy about it
